Transaction fe70fffa5e2a9b4a763022295396f56743e6eae29198297b52d0fea7a81ef662

16 Input
2 Outputs
  • fe70fffa5e2a9b4a763022295396f56743e6eae29198297b52d0fea7a81ef662:0
  • value  7341839
    address  13Ewbw7Gi9ggFEz82q2dP5LTuXZ4c7p75V
  • fe70fffa5e2a9b4a763022295396f56743e6eae29198297b52d0fea7a81ef662:1
  • value  350644
    address  3BMCM4zr5VwdMKAEhmuRYaiWRcYj753HEd